How Chronic Stress Quietly Weakens Your Immune System
Quick Answer: Chronic (not occasional) stress keeps cortisol elevated for extended periods, and sustained high cortisol suppresses immune cell activity and increases inflammation — which is why people going through prolonged stressful periods tend to catch more colds and heal more slowly, not because stress is ‘just mental.’
You’ve probably noticed it: the cold that hits during finals week, the flu that shows up right after a brutal work quarter. That’s not bad luck lining up with bad timing.

Why does short-term stress not cause the same problem as chronic stress?
Short bursts of cortisol are actually protective — they’re part of a normal fight-or-flight response that briefly redirects energy toward immediate survival needs and can even mobilize immune cells short-term.
The problem is duration: when cortisol stays elevated for weeks or months instead of hours, it starts suppressing the production and function of lymphocytes (a key immune cell type), which is where the ‘stressed people get sick more’ pattern actually comes from.
What does chronically suppressed immunity actually look like day to day?
It usually shows up as catching colds more frequently, taking longer to recover from minor illness, and cold sores or other latent viruses reactivating more often than usual — all signs that immune surveillance is running below baseline.
It’s rarely dramatic. Most people notice it in hindsight, connecting a rough few months at work to an unusual string of sick days.

Myth vs Fact: Stress and Immunity
Myth: ‘Being stressed’ for a day or two will tank your immune system. Fact: acute, short-term stress isn’t the issue — it’s weeks-to-months of unrelenting stress that measurably suppresses immune function.
Myth: You can’t do anything about it without removing the stressor. Fact: while removing the source helps most, sleep quality, movement, and social connection all measurably buffer cortisol’s immune impact even when the stressor itself is ongoing.
Myth: Supplements can offset chronic stress’s immune impact. Fact: no supplement outperforms addressing sleep debt and stress load directly — supplements are a minor lever next to those two.
What actually buffers the immune impact of a stressful period?
- Protecting sleep even when everything else is falling apart — sleep loss compounds with cortisol to suppress immunity further, so this is the highest-leverage lever
- Maintaining light-to-moderate movement rather than stopping entirely or overtraining, both of which can add further physical stress
- Real social connection, which has a measurable buffering effect on stress hormone levels independent of the stressor itself
- Not stacking new stressors voluntarily during an already high-stress window (this isn’t the season to also start an aggressive diet or training program)
FAQ: Stress and Immune System Questions, Answered
Can stress alone make you sick without exposure to a virus?
No — stress suppresses your defenses against pathogens you’re exposed to, but it doesn’t create illness out of nothing; you still need exposure to a virus or bacteria.
How long does stress need to last before it affects immunity?
Most research points to sustained stress over several weeks as the threshold where measurable immune suppression appears, not isolated stressful days.
Does exercise help or hurt immunity during a stressful period?
Moderate exercise generally helps by managing stress hormones, but very intense or excessive training on top of an already high-stress period can add to the total load rather than relieve it.
